Gaming Cafe Franchise vs. Independent Ownership: Which Path is Right for Your Venture?

Compare the pros and cons of franchising versus independent ownership for launching a successful gaming cafe business.

Starting a gaming cafe is an exciting venture, tapping into the booming market for entertainment and community. However, before diving in, one of the most critical decisions is choosing between the structured path of a franchise and the autonomy of independent ownership. While both offer pathways to profitability, the operational realities, financial planning, and risk profiles are vastly different.

Understanding these differences is essential for setting up a sustainable business model. Understanding the Franchise Model for Gaming Cafes

The Appeal of a Franchise

  • Established System: Franchises come with proven operational blueprints, which can reduce the initial guesswork.
  • Brand Recognition: You benefit immediately from an established brand name, potentially reducing marketing overhead.
  • Support Structure: Franchisees receive ongoing support regarding training, supply chains, and operational management.

Potential Limitations of Franchising

  • Reduced Flexibility: Decision-making can be limited, as you must adhere to the franchisor's established protocols.
  • Royalty Fees: Ongoing royalty payments can increase long-term operational costs.
  • Less Control Over Branding: Your ability to customize the cafe experience is constrained by the franchise agreement.

The Autonomy of Independent Ownership

Maximizing Control and Potential Rewards

  • Full Control: You have complete autonomy over décor, game selection, pricing, and operational procedures.
  • Higher Potential Earnings: Independent setups can offer higher rewards if managed effectively, as noted by owners of independent arcade cafes.
  • Adaptability: You can tailor the cafe experience precisely to your local market demands.

Managing the Risks

  • Startup Complexity: You are responsible for sourcing all operational knowledge and establishing processes from scratch.
  • Market Risk: Success heavily depends on your ability to independently navigate location choice (where urban settings might add significant build-out costs) and local competition.

Financial Planning: Comparing Startup Costs and Business Models

When estimating startup costs for a gaming cafe, the business model choice directly impacts your investment. Independent setups often offer greater flexibility over franchise costs, allowing you to optimize spending based on specific local market conditions.

  1. 1Step 1: Define Your Investment Scope (CapEx vs. OpEx). Determine if you are buying a pre-packaged system or building it custom.
  2. 2Step 2: Analyze Local Costs. Factor in location-specific rent and build-out costs, which can vary significantly based on urban versus suburban settings.
  3. 3Step 3: Model Revenue Streams. Project potential earnings based on your chosen structure (franchise fees vs. direct profit margins).

Highlight: Independent gaming cafe setups often offer higher rewards with added risk, demanding rigorous financial forecasting.
